Green River planning commission reports resignation, one seat open

Summary

Commission staff announced the resignation of commissioner Dustin (last name not specified), leaving one vacancy. The person appointed will complete the remainder of the term, which ends in 2027.

At the June 17, 2025 meeting the City of Green River Planning Commission announced the resignation of commissioner Dustin, creating a single vacancy on the commission.

Staff said Dustin resigned because he is working out of state and is unable to commit to attending meetings; the resignation leaves roughly two years remaining on his term. Staff reported having two people express interest in the vacancy and explained that whoever is appointed will serve the remainder of Dustin’s term.

The staff summary included a review of current commission terms: one commissioner’s term was noted as expiring in December 2025, other members’ terms were listed through 2026–2029. Commissioners also observed that potential changes in membership could occur if members successfully run for City Council.
